Canton Tower of China

The Canton Tower of Guangzhou in China is truly a modern and spectacular architecture with phenomenal design which is also the tallest TV tower in the lovely planet. The Canton Tower of China is also the tallest structure ever built in the People’s Republic of China. The construction of the Canton Tower was started in the November, 2005 and it was completed in 2010.

The Canton Tower was designed to represent a graceful lady look with transparent and curvy style. The Canton Tower was designed by the Dutch architects Mark Hemel ,Barbara Kuit together with Arup with an aim to construct a unique emblem of the Guangzhou city. The most phenomenal feature of the Canton Tower is its amazing lighting and it looks so alive and non symmetrical. The interior of the Canton Tower consists of the programmatic zones with various functions, including TV and radio transmission facilities, observatory decks, revolving restaurants, computer gaming, restaurants, exhibition spaces, conference rooms, shops, and 4D cinemas.

The Canton Tower of China is also recognized with its Chinese Nick name ′Xiao Man Yao′.″ which means “young girl with tight waist”. The Canton Tower attracts the visitors for its extraordinary structure and the wonderful facilities provided by the management. The Canton Tower of China is also one of the most energy-saving and environment friendly green buildings in the world.
